Basement Water Removal in Phoenix, AZ
Basement water removal services focus on eliminating excess moisture, standing water, or flooding from basement areas to protect the property and prevent damage. These services are commonly requested after heavy rains, plumbing issues, or unexpected leaks that result in water accumulation. Projects may include water extraction, drying, and moisture control to ensure the basement is thoroughly dried and free from standing water, helping to reduce the risk of mold growth and structural deterioration.
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of water removal, the methods used to extract water, and the steps taken to dry and dehumidify the space effectively. It’s also important to consider whether additional repairs, such as sealing cracks or addressing drainage problems, are recommended to prevent future water intrusion. Clear communication about the process and what to expect can help property owners make informed decisions about restoring their basement after water issues occur.

Common Basement Water Removal Jobs
Basement Water Removal - Removes excess water caused by flooding or leaks to prevent further damage.
Flood Cleanup - Clears standing water and debris after heavy rains or burst pipes.
Sump Pump Installation - Adds sump pumps to help manage groundwater and prevent basement flooding.
Water Damage Restoration - Restores basement areas affected by water intrusion to their original condition.
Drainage System Services - Improves exterior drainage to divert water away from the foundation.
Mold Prevention - Addresses moisture issues to prevent mold growth in basement spaces.
Basement Water Removal Questions
What causes basement water issues? Common causes include leaks, poor drainage, and high groundwater levels that can lead to water infiltration.
How can water damage be prevented in a basement? Proper waterproofing, drainage improvements, and maintaining gutters help reduce the risk of water intrusion.
What types of water removal services are available? Services typically include water extraction, drying, and moisture removal to restore a dry basement environment.
Is it necessary to remove standing water immediately? Yes, removing standing water quickly helps prevent further damage and mold growth in the basement.
